Rudolf Donath (politician)

Rudolf Donath (born March 30, 1908 in Hamburg ; † May 20, 1986 ) was a German politician ( SPD ). He was mayor of Börnsen and from 1968 to 1971 a member of the state parliament of Schleswig-Holstein .

Life

Rudolf Donath worked professionally as an administrative clerk. He was already a member of the SPD from April 1, 1928 to 1933 and rejoined the SPD on February 3, 1946 after World War II . He later became chairman of the SPD district and mayor of Börnsen.

On November 18, 1968, he was as substitutes member of the Schleswig-Holstein parliament and remained a deputy until the end of the sixth legislature on May 15, 1971. During his time as a Member of Parliament he was a member of the Committees for expellees and for public health.
